Service Level Manager - SLA Specialist
Location: London (Hybrid)
Rate: £405 per day OUTSIDE IR35
Start date: ASAP
6 months initial (extension likely)

Are you ready to lead the charge in establishing and optimising Service Level Management?

We're seeking an Service Level Manager to join a dynamic Service Integration and Management (SIAM) team.

Key Responsibilities:

Establish and lead the Service Level Management Framework.
Ensure precise, assessable, and achievable service levels that support business requirements.
Collaborate with internal teams, suppliers, and vendors to drive performance improvements.
Convert SLAs & OLAs into measurable formulas for accurate reporting.
Oversee governance, reporting, and improvement initiatives across the ecosystem.

Requirements:
ITIL accreditation (minimum Practitioner level).
ServiceNow experience
Proficient in Defining SLAs and Reporting
Proficiency in the understanding of configuring Service Level Management in Service Now.
Lead the initiation and establishment of SLM processes across the ecosystem. Manage diverse service providers and metrics to ensure consistent, high-quality service delivery.
